Do you mean the one that plays when Dawn picks up Piplup to stop it from crying and tells him there is no need to worry, they will see the others again? Because that is the Japanese ending song "Lalala to your heart".
Another song that played was "Tears after the cloudy weather" which played when Pikachu and Piplup were crying and Togekiss was acting like a mother, before Meowth interupted.
And another piano song was the last one, which played as Brock and Ash said goodbye, this one I cannot find, and its something like "Friends Forever" or something, but its from the 3rd Pikachu short with the Pichu Brothers in the city, it was the ending song for that. Hope this helps.
